Tomorrow at 8:30 AM EDT The Grand Lodge of Pennsylvania Academy of Masonic Knowledge will hold its "Spring" Symposium at the Masonic Cultural Center in the Elizabethtown, PA Masonic Village. I will be in attendance along with over 300 others.

There will be two presenters at this Symposium, Bro. Richard Berman, the 2016 UGLE Prestonian Lecturer offer his work, "Foundations: New Light on the Formation and Early Years of the Grand Lodge of England," and Bro Adam G Kendell, Editor of The Plumbline for the Scottish Rite Research Society, offering his work, "The Geometry of Mystery: Ancient Egypt, Freemasonry, and Secret Societies."

The Symposium will be available as a live stream via the Grand Lodge YouTube channel if anyone is interested. Sometime after the symposium it will be available for playback on the YouTube channel or via a link from the Academy's web page.
